How it works
Fluid flowing through the meter impinges on turbine blades free to rotate about an axis along the centre line of the housing. The angular (rotational) velocity of the rotor is directly proportional to the fluid velocity, and the resulting signal is taken by an electrical pick-off mounted on the flow meter body.
Features
-
Individually calibrated, K factor marked
Each fitting is individually calibrated and marked with its K factor in ml/pulse.
-
Ceramic ball bearing
Ceramic ball bearing for superior low flow performance.
-
High-level 5 VDC signal
High level (5 VDC) signal can be run up to 100 ft without a transmitter.
-
Linear pulse output
Pulse output is linear to the flow rate, with high-frequency pulse resolution to account for minute increments of flow.
-
Full bore and insertion models
1 in full bore turbine type; insertion type available for 1.5, 2, 2.5, 3, 4, 6, 8 and 12 in line sizes.
-
Five operating modes
Indicator & Totalizer, Batcher, Flow Comparator, Rate Switch Mode and Pulser.
-
Batcher with halt and reject
Relay energizes on start and remains energized until a fixed quantity of liquid passes the sensor; the batcher has halt and reject batch functions.
-
Flow comparator mode
Two sensors on permeate and reject lines; the meter displays both flow rates, calculates percentage recovery and alarms on reducing recovery.
-
Rate switch mode
Relay energizes whenever actual flow falls below or rises above the set value, with LOW/HIGH FLOW RATE shown on the display - suited to flow interlock and chemical dosing.
-
Pulser mode
Triggers a task on completion of a preset volume; can be configured to any metering or dosing pump.
-
Self-locating insertion probe
Fitting is automatic since the probe is set at the correct depth and orientation.
-
PVC tee adaptors available
Insertion type sensor is also available with solvent cementable adaptors for PVC tees at extra cost.
-
Recommended straight run
For best results, provide a straight run of 10D upstream and 5D downstream.

| Installation Requirements | |
| T-connection upstream distance | 10 DN distance upstream the flow meter |
| Gate valve clearance | Keep 5 meters between the axis of the flow meter and the axis of the gate valve located downstream |
| Recommended orientation | Vertical / inclined pipe with upward flow direction; avoid installation in vertical pipes with free outlet |
| Pump position | Always install the sensor downstream the pump and NEVER upstream to avoid vacuum |
| Strainer | Prevent solid particles entering the sensor; fix a strainer before the sensor / flow tube |
| Maintenance | It is mandatory to clean sensor over periodically to ensure best performance |
